The nurse should preop preparation is crucial, nurse also support
during adjustment to concept of amputation, surgical resection. Body image
concerns especially in teens and pain management-phantom limb pain is real. Therapeutic
management for osteogenic sarcoma, traditional approach: radical surgical
resection or amputation of affected area are Limb-salvage procedures: resection
of bone w/prosthetic replacement of affected area. Chemo w/surgical treatment.
